Bellingham to St Helier (London) by train

A train trip from Bellingham to St Helier (London) takes about 1hrs 14 mins on average, covering roughly 8 miles (13 kilometres). With around 57 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£5.50,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

What are my cheap ticket options for Bellingham to St Helier (London) journeys?

From booking in Advance, to our FairSplits, here are our tips for you to find the best price

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Facilities and Convenience at Bellingham Station

Bellingham Station is equipped to facilitate easy ticket purchases with its ticket office open from Monday to Friday between 06:10 and 19:30, and on weekends with reduced hours. You’ll find ticket machines that also accommodate those travelers with a Disabled Persons Railcard. There's a seamless provision for collecting tickets bought online, ensuring that your travel plans remain uninterrupted. Expect to find all crucial customer information displayed on screens accompanied by regular announcements.

While Bellingham does well in terms of its ticketing services, the station sacrifices some amenities in other areas. It lacks step-free access, which may pose challenges for those with mobility issues—though assistance can be readily arranged through staffed help points. Security measures include CCTV coverage, providing peace of mind for those using the bicycle storage facilities or waiting for trains.

Facilities and Amenities

While St Helier station prides itself on having a working blend of modern services in a community-friendly environment, it offers basic yet essential amenities. It does not contain a formal ticket office, yet you can easily purchase or collect your tickets via the automated machines available. These machines are accessible and cater to Disabled Persons Railcard discounts, keeping accessibility at the forefront.

St Helier might not boast luxurious amenities; there are no toilets, baby changing facilities, waiting rooms, or refreshment stands. However, seating is available should you need to rest before your journey. For those on two wheels, the station caters with 30 bicycle storage spaces that are secure and CCTV-monitored. Despite its modest offerings, the presence of its accessible ticket machines and induction loops makes it a commendable choice for efficient travel.
